8. ScreenerBot Desktop Application
8.1 Server Connections
The ScreenerBot desktop application makes only TWO connections to our servers:
- Version Check: A simple GET request to check for software updates (no personal data is transmitted)
- Billboard Tokens: A GET request to fetch featured tokens for display (no personal data is transmitted)
All other connections are to third-party services you configure or public APIs:
- Your configured RPC endpoint(s) for Solana blockchain data
- DexScreener, GeckoTerminal for market data
- RugCheck for security analysis
- Jupiter/routers for swap quotes and transaction building
8.2 Events System
ScreenerBot includes an optional events recording system for debugging purposes:
- Disabled by default - You must explicitly enable it
- Records system events locally (token discoveries, swap attempts, errors)
- Never records private keys, passwords, or seed phrases
- Data is stored only on your computer and never transmitted to us
- When enabled, can record millions of events per hour during active trading
- With events debugging enabled, storage can grow to 20 GB due to high-frequency logging—use only when troubleshooting
- You may optionally share event logs with support for troubleshooting (we recommend reviewing before sharing)
8.3 Third-Party Image Sources
Token and NFT images displayed in ScreenerBot are fetched from external sources:
- DexScreener CDN (cdn.dexscreener.com)
- IPFS gateways (ipfs.io and others)
- Arweave network (arweave.net)
- Individual token project servers and CDNs
We have no control over these image sources. Token projects host their own images on their own infrastructure. If images fail to load, the source server may be offline or blocked by your firewall. This does not affect trading functionality.
